Genital ulcers are open sores that appear on the genitalia, including the external genitalia, vulva, penis, scrotum, or perineum. These ulcers can vary in size, shape, and appearance, and they can be painful or asymptomatic. Genital ulcers can result from a range of causes, including sexually transmitted infections (STIs) such as herpes simplex virus (HSV) and syphilis. Herpes typically presents as multiple, small, painful sores, while syphilis may cause a single, painless ulcer known as a chancre. Other potential causes include chancroid, a bacterial infection that leads to painful, necrotic ulcers, and granuloma inguinale, which results in large, beefy-red ulcers. Non-infectious causes of genital ulcers may include trauma, such as from friction or injury, and inflammatory conditions like Behçet's disease or inflammatory bowel disease.
Treatment for genital ulcers depends on the underlying cause. For ulcers caused by STIs, specific antiviral, antibiotic, or antifungal medications are used to treat the infection. For instance, antiviral medications such as acyclovir or valacyclovir are prescribed for herpes, while antibiotics like penicillin are used for syphilis. Analgesics and topical treatments can help manage pain and discomfort associated with the ulcers. Proper hygiene and avoiding irritants or triggers, such as certain soaps or sexual activity, can aid in healing and prevent further irritation. In cases where ulcers are related to non-infectious causes, addressing the underlying condition with appropriate medical management is essential. Consulting a healthcare provider for accurate diagnosis and treatment is crucial, as genital ulcers can be a sign of serious health conditions and require tailored therapeutic approaches. Regular follow-up and adherence to treatment are important for effective management and prevention of complications.
